This subtle minty thick green gravy is spicy and tasty. the chole adds a zing to it .

Makes 4 serving
1/2 cup boiled chick peas
1/2 cup spinach (palak) puree
2 tbsp chopped mint leaves (phudina)
1 tbsp garam masala
1 tbsp chilli powder
1 tbsp green chilli paste
1/4 cup fresh cream
1 tsp shahi cumin seeds (jeera)
2 tbsp ghee
1 tsp lemon juice
coriander (dhania) for garnising
Method
- Method
- Heat the ghee in a kadhai and fry the cumin seeds.
- When the seeds begins to crackle, add the chilli paste and cook till it changes colour.
- Add the mint leaves and spinach puree and bring to a boil.
- Add the cream and all the spices and lemon juice and cook for a minute.
- Add the chick peas and add 1/4 cup water.
- Cover and let it simmer for 5 minutes.
- Add the salt, mix well and cook for a minute.
- Remove from the flame and garnish with coriander.
- Serve hot.
